Guest Dr Pickles

A top night with two enthusiastic promoters in Alfie and Chilli.

A great room with low ceiling, all dance floor, cheap bar at one end away from the dancers and it's own smoking garden / patio. All completely separate from the pub.

Music policy was truly across the board. Alfie made it very clear that I was to play exactly what I wanted. Don't worry about the floor and don't play safe. So I did just that. Loved it.

After 3 years Alfie and Chilli know their crowd and with all the DJs getting two spots there was a real mix of well thought out soul across the whole spectrum.

Interesting crowd with everyone in a party mood and open ears. Large, well dressed skinheads dancing to 70's crossover and dainty, high heeled ladies giving it large to some down and dirty R&B. A real mix of friendly people having a great time.

On a personal note we were made to feel very welcome. Great to meet some faces from Bournemouth such as Bob Snow and Tim Smithers. But the real bonus was bumping into two friends who used to live in Hemel but had moved to Southampton. Great company and lots of laughs.
